Captain Gary G. Montalvo
Director, Maritime Headquarters and Theater Sustainment
Download
Gary Montalvo, a native of Santurce, Puerto Rico graduated from USNA in 1997. He earned an M.B.A from George Washington University, and a M.A in National Security Studies and International Security from Regent University. He is a 2021 MIT Seminar XXI Fellow.
A career Submariner, his operational assignments include service on fast attack and ballistic missile submarines both in the Atlantic and Pacific. He deployed to the Western Pacific, the European theater, and completed strategic deterrent patrols. He served on USS ANNAPOLIS (SSN-760), USS PENNSYLVANIA (SSBN-735) (BLUE), USS TEXAS (SSN-775). He commanded the USS NORTH CAROLINA (SSN-777) and served as Commodore SUBDEVRON FIVE.
Staff Assignments include Flag LT to COMUSNAVSO, Flag Aide to DCNO OPNAV N3/N5, Technical Representative to the Director of Naval Reactors, Deputy Executive Assistant to COMPACFLT, Prospective Commanding Officer Instructor, and Program Analyst in the Office of the Secretary of Defense. Most recently he served as Division Director, Submarine & Nuclear Officer Distribution (PERS 42), Nuclear Community Manager (N133), Executive Assistant to the INDOPACOM Commander.
He serves as the Director of Maritime Headquarters and Theater Sustainment at COMPACFLT.
